Output cf608a3558256372e3172fa8088629716fde1e0c378d18a476e855cb92c3757e:2

value
4446028140
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 64389a2bb9698b0ac36b4bc5eb170f16e68473ce3884216db2c0b435501c416d
address
tb1pvsuf52aedx9s4smtf0z7k9c0zmnggu7w8zzzzmdjcz6r25qug9ksuxnj8h
transaction
cf608a3558256372e3172fa8088629716fde1e0c378d18a476e855cb92c3757e
confirmations
17515
spent
true